Comprehensive Fire Hazard Identification and Assessment

A thorough fire safety risk assessment begins with identifying all potential fire hazards within your premises. Our experienced assessors from The Oltec Group conduct detailed inspections across Nailsworth, Gloucestershire properties, examining flammable materials such as chemicals, paper stocks, textiles, and combustible furnishings that could fuel a fire. We systematically evaluate electrical installations, identifying faulty wiring, overloaded circuits, damaged equipment, and aging electrical systems that pose ignition risks. Heat sources including cooking equipment, heating systems, and machinery are scrutinised for potential fire triggers. Additionally, we assess storage practices, waste management procedures, and housekeeping standards that could contribute to fire spread, ensuring every hazard is documented and addressed.

Evaluating Occupant Vulnerability During Fire Incidents

Identifying vulnerable individuals who may be at greater risk during a fire emergency is a crucial component of comprehensive fire safety risk assessments. Oltec Services assessors throughout Nailsworth, Gloucestershire carefully evaluate who uses your building, considering employees, visitors, contractors, and members of the public. We pay particular attention to lone workers who may be isolated in remote areas of the premises, elderly individuals who might have reduced mobility or slower reaction times, and disabled persons requiring assistance or additional time to evacuate. Our assessment examines people working night shifts, those unfamiliar with the premises, individuals with hearing or visual impairments, and anyone with cognitive difficulties that could impede their escape. This detailed analysis ensures your fire safety measures and evacuation procedures accommodate everyone's needs.

Implementing Effective Fire Safety Control Measures

Once hazards and vulnerable persons are identified, Oltec FM assessors across Nailsworth, Gloucestershire evaluate existing fire safety measures and develop strategies to eliminate or reduce risks to acceptable levels. We examine all escape routes, ensuring they remain unobstructed, clearly marked, and adequately lit with emergency lighting systems. Fire exits are assessed for compliance, checking they open easily in the direction of escape, remain unlocked during occupancy hours, and lead to safe assembly points. Our evaluation includes fire detection and alarm systems, firefighting equipment placement, compartmentation integrity, and staff training adequacy. Where risks cannot be eliminated entirely, we recommend proportionate control measures such as improved fire separation, enhanced detection systems, additional signage, and upgraded emergency lighting to protect all occupants effectively.

Compliance Records and Emergency Evacuation Planning

Maintaining accurate fire safety records and implementing effective training programs demonstrate regulatory compliance while protecting lives and property throughout Nailsworth, Gloucestershire, which is why Oltec Facilities Management delivers comprehensive documentation and planning services. Our fire risk assessment reports provide detailed findings covering every hazard identified, risk evaluation outcomes, existing safety measures, and prioritised action plans with realistic completion dates. These legally required documents prove your compliance with fire safety duties and inform future reviews and updates. We assist in creating site-specific emergency evacuation plans that account for building layout, occupancy levels, and vulnerable persons requiring assistance. Training programmes are designed to ensure all staff understand their fire safety responsibilities, can operate fire extinguishers correctly, recognise alarm signals, and execute evacuation procedures calmly and efficiently.
